What: Mathathon is a huge fundraiser for Sunrise with 100% of the proceeds going directly to the school.
When: February 1 was the Kick-off. Please see the timeline below.
Why: Sunrise Drive FFO raises tens of thousands of dollars for field trips, artists-in-residence, Community Garden, 5th grade legacy project and dozens of other campus programs through Mathathon. Our families achieve this while students have fun studying math — it’s a true win/win for Sunrise and students!
How: Students get pledges from family and friends for either (a) each math problem answered correctly on the Test Day (March 12), or (b) a flat amount.
